Fan Loyalty and Economic Incentives

Fan loyalty, while often perceived as intrinsic, is significantly influenced by economic incentives. Teams that consistently perform well, backed by sound financial management, tend to foster stronger and more enduring fan bases. The economic success of a team can translate into a more positive fan experience through better facilities, more exciting game-day atmospheres, and the acquisition of star players, all of which enhance the perceived value of being a fan.

Moreover, the economic relationship between fans and teams extends beyond ticket purchases. Merchandise, concessions, and even media subscriptions are all economic transactions that solidify the fan’s commitment. Strategies employed by sports organizations to maximize these revenue streams often aim to tap into and strengthen the emotional bonds fans have, demonstrating a sophisticated understanding of the economic psychology of fandom.

Team Valuations and Market Dynamics

The valuation of sports teams is a fascinating area where economic principles are on full display. Factors such as league revenue sharing, media rights deals, brand equity, and market size all contribute to a team’s financial worth. These valuations are not static; they fluctuate based on on-field performance, strategic management, and broader economic trends, mirroring the dynamics of any major industry.

The economic health of teams and leagues directly impacts the competitive landscape. Wealthier franchises can often outspend rivals in player acquisition and development, creating a stratification that can influence the predictability of outcomes. This economic disparity is a critical consideration for anyone analyzing the sports market, including those interested in sports betting, where perceived value can be heavily influenced by a team’s financial standing and market strength.
